Product Description:
The Okuma resourceful component E4809-032-319-G shows an advanced Circuit Card board for several applications of industrial automation. The Okuma product line uses precision engineering to achieve sturdy reliable devices which work efficiently worldwide.
The E4809-032-319-G circuit board acts as a top card DC servo unit which operates properly when temperatures stay between 0°C to 40°C and humidity levels reach 90% maximum. The board boasts electrolytic capacitors as its main components are blue cylindrical components used for power filtering while stabilizing voltage levels. Capsule-shaped electrolytic capacitors on the board range from 10V to 100V in voltage ratings while possessing capacitance measurements from 10µF to 4700µF that aid in eliminating voltage disturbances effectively. The large cylindrical red power resistors function to manage high currents by utilizing resistances from 1 ohm to 10 ohms for both controlled power release and the safety of sensitive circuits against excessive current flow. The 1N4007 type of rectifier diode functions as an AC-to-DC power converter to establish a constant power supply for CNC servo motors. Zener diodes protect sensitive electronic components from unexpected voltage surges through their role as voltage clamps and overvoltage protection devices with available ratings between 3V to 15V.
The E4809-032-319-G circuit board uses transistors by including Bipolar Junction Transistors (BJTs) to improve signal amplification and switching functions. These semiconductor devices regulate the flow of electrical signals within the system by ensuring proper motor control and feedback response. The three-legged transistor components are often mounted with heat sinks and provide stable output voltages of +5V, +12V and -12V which aids in ensuring a well-regulated power. The carbon film and metal film resistors used on the board provide a resistance spectrum from ohms to kilo-ohms for vital work in current restriction.
Frequently Asked Questions about E4809-032-319-G:
Q: What voltage ratings does the E4809-032-319-G support?
A: This unit provides regulated +12V and -12V outputs, along with high-capacitance electrolytic capacitors to stabilize voltage fluctuations and support consistent CNC machine operation.
Q: What is the operating temperature range of the E4809-032-319-G?
A: It is designed for 0°C to 40°C, making it suitable for various industrial CNC environments while ensuring stable motor feedback and voltage regulation.
Q: How does the E4809-032-319-G handle noise suppression?
A: The board features ceramic and film capacitors, along with ferrite core inductors, which filter high-frequency noise, reducing electromagnetic interference (EMI) in CNC motor control circuits.
Q: How does the E4809-032-319-G integrate into CNC systems?
A: The gold finger edge connectors enable direct integration with Okuma CNC controllers, providing a secure, high-speed connection for efficient signal transmission.
Q: What do the diodes play role in the E4809-032-319-G?
A: Rectifier diodes convert AC to DC, ensuring a stable power supply, while Zener diodes offer overvoltage protection, preventing component damage.
